In a parking lot, the # of ordinary cars is larger than the # of sports utility vehicles. by 94.7%. The difference btwn the # of cars and the # of SUV's is 18. Find the # of SUV's.

~My thoughts and work:

C= Cars #
S= SUV #

C-S= 18

(C/S)*100= 94.7%

Can I replace the C with the equation
since:
C-S= 18 so
C= S+18
thus....

[(S+18)/S] x 100= 94.7%

However after this I get a negative
S= -339

Your equation that deals with the C/S ratio is wrong. It should be
C/S = 1.947,
since (C-S)/S = 94.7% = 0.947
Combine that with C - S = 18

1.947 S - S = 18
0.947 S = 18
S = 19
